2015-09-18libata: increase the timeout when setting transfer modeMikulas Patocka
commit d531be2ca2f27cca5f041b6a140504999144a617 upstream. I have a ST4000DM000 disk. If Linux is booted while the disk is spun down, the command that sets transfer mode causes the disk to spin up. The spin-up takes longer than the default 5s timeout, so the command fails and timeout is reported. Fix this by increasing the timeout to 15s, which is enough for the disk to spin up. 2015-09-18e1000: add dummy allocator to fix race condition between mtu change and netpollSabrina Dubroca
commit 08e8331654d1d7b2c58045e549005bc356aa7810 upstream. There is a race condition between e1000_change_mtu's cleanups and netpoll, when we change the MTU across jumbo size: Changing MTU frees all the rx buffers: e1000_change_mtu -> e1000_down -> e1000_clean_all_rx_rings -> e1000_clean_rx_ring Then, close to the end of e1000_change_mtu: pr_info -> ... -> netpoll_poll_dev -> e1000_clean -> e1000_clean_rx_irq -> e1000_alloc_rx_buffers -> e1000_alloc_frag And when we come back to do the rest of the MTU change: e1000_up -> e1000_configure -> e1000_configure_rx -> e1000_alloc_jumbo_rx_buffers alloc_jumbo finds the buffers already != NULL, since data (shared with page in e1000_rx_buffer->rxbuf) has been re-alloc'd, but it's garbage, or at least not what is expected when in jumbo state. This results in an unusable adapter (packets don't get through), and a NULL pointer dereference on the next call to e1000_clean_rx_ring (other mtu change, link down, shutdown): BUG: unable to handle kernel NULL pointer dereference at (null) IP: [<ffffffff81194d6e>] put_compound_page+0x7e/0x330 [...] Call Trace: [<ffffffff81195445>] put_page+0x55/0x60 [<ffffffff815d9f44>] e1000_clean_rx_ring+0x134/0x200 [<ffffffff815da055>] e1000_clean_all_rx_rings+0x45/0x60 [<ffffffff815df5e0>] e1000_down+0x1c0/0x1d0 [<ffffffff811e2260>] ? deactivate_slab+0x7f0/0x840 [<ffffffff815e21bc>] e1000_change_mtu+0xdc/0x170 [<ffffffff81647050>] dev_set_mtu+0xa0/0x140 [<ffffffff81664218>] do_setlink+0x218/0xac0 [<ffffffff814459e9>] ? nla_parse+0xb9/0x120 [<ffffffff816652d0>] rtnl_newlink+0x6d0/0x890 [<ffffffff8104f000>] ? kvm_clock_read+0x20/0x40 [<ffffffff810a2068>] ? sched_clock_cpu+0xa8/0x100 [<ffffffff81663802>] rtnetlink_rcv_msg+0x92/0x260 By setting the allocator to a dummy version, netpoll can't mess up our rx buffers. The allocator is set back to a sane value in e1000_configure_rx. 2015-05-24spi: spidev: fix possible arithmetic overflow for multi-transfer messageIan Abbott
commit f20fbaad7620af2df36a1f9d1c9ecf48ead5b747 upstream. `spidev_message()` sums the lengths of the individual SPI transfers to determine the overall SPI message length. It restricts the total length, returning an error if too long, but it does not check for arithmetic overflow. For example, if the SPI message consisted of two transfers and the first has a length of 10 and the second has a length of (__u32)(-1), the total length would be seen as 9, even though the second transfer is actually very long. If the second transfer specifies a null `rx_buf` and a non-null `tx_buf`, the `copy_from_user()` could overrun the spidev's pre-allocated tx buffer before it reaches an invalid user memory address. Fix it by checking that neither the total nor the individual transfer lengths exceed the maximum allowed value. Thanks to Dan Carpenter for reporting the potential integer overflow. 2014-11-23net: pppoe: use correct channel MTU when using Multilink PPPChristoph Schulz
The PPP channel MTU is used with Multilink PPP when ppp_mp_explode() (see ppp_generic module) tries to determine how big a fragment might be. According to RFC 1661, the MTU excludes the 2-byte PPP protocol field, see the corresponding comment and code in ppp_mp_explode(): /* * hdrlen includes the 2-byte PPP protocol field, but the * MTU counts only the payload excluding the protocol field. * (RFC1661 Section 2) */ mtu = pch->chan->mtu - (hdrlen - 2); However, the pppoe module *does* include the PPP protocol field in the channel MTU, which is wrong as it causes the PPP payload to be 1-2 bytes too big under certain circumstances (one byte if PPP protocol compression is used, two otherwise), causing the generated Ethernet packets to be dropped. So the pppoe module has to subtract two bytes from the channel MTU. This error only manifests itself when using Multilink PPP, as otherwise the channel MTU is not used anywhere. In the following, I will describe how to reproduce this bug. We configure two pppd instances for multilink PPP over two PPPoE links, say eth2 and eth3, with a MTU of 1492 bytes for each link and a MRRU of 2976 bytes. (This MRRU is computed by adding the two link MTUs and subtracting the MP header twice, which is 4 bytes long.) The necessary pppd statements on both sides are "multilink mtu 1492 mru 1492 mrru 2976". On the client side, we additionally need "plugin rp-pppoe.so eth2" and "plugin rp-pppoe.so eth3", respectively; on the server side, we additionally need to start two pppoe-server instances to be able to establish two PPPoE sessions, one over eth2 and one over eth3. We set the MTU of the PPP network interface to the MRRU (2976) on both sides of the connection in order to make use of the higher bandwidth. (If we didn't do that, IP fragmentation would kick in, which we want to avoid.) Now we send a ICMPv4 echo request with a payload of 2948 bytes from client to server over the PPP link. This results in the following network packet: 2948 (echo payload) + 8 (ICMPv4 header) + 20 (IPv4 header) --------------------- 2976 (PPP payload) These 2976 bytes do not exceed the MTU of the PPP network interface, so the IP packet is not fragmented. Now the multilink PPP code in ppp_mp_explode() prepends one protocol byte (0x21 for IPv4), making the packet one byte bigger than the negotiated MRRU. So this packet would have to be divided in three fragments. But this does not happen as each link MTU is assumed to be two bytes larger. So this packet is diveded into two fragments only, one of size 1489 and one of size 1488. Now we have for that bigger fragment: 1489 (PPP payload) + 4 (MP header) + 2 (PPP protocol field for the MP payload (0x3d)) + 6 (PPPoE header) -------------------------- 1501 (Ethernet payload) This packet exceeds the link MTU and is discarded. If one configures the link MTU on the client side to 1501, one can see the discarded Ethernet frames with tcpdump running on the client. A ping -s 2948 -c 1 192.168.15.254 leads to the smaller fragment that is correctly received on the server side: (tcpdump -vvvne -i eth3 pppoes and ppp proto 0x3d) 52:54:00:ad:87:fd > 52:54:00:79:5c:d0, ethertype PPPoE S (0x8864), length 1514: PPPoE [ses 0x3] MLPPP (0x003d), length 1494: seq 0x000, Flags [end], length 1492 and to the bigger fragment that is not received on the server side: (tcpdump -vvvne -i eth2 pppoes and ppp proto 0x3d) 52:54:00:70:9e:89 > 52:54:00:5d:6f:b0, ethertype PPPoE S (0x8864), length 1515: PPPoE [ses 0x5] MLPPP (0x003d), length 1495: seq 0x000, Flags [begin], length 1493 With the patch below, we correctly obtain three fragments: 52:54:00:ad:87:fd > 52:54:00:79:5c:d0, ethertype PPPoE S (0x8864), length 1514: PPPoE [ses 0x1] MLPPP (0x003d), length 1494: seq 0x000, Flags [begin], length 1492 52:54:00:70:9e:89 > 52:54:00:5d:6f:b0, ethertype PPPoE S (0x8864), length 1514: PPPoE [ses 0x1] MLPPP (0x003d), length 1494: seq 0x000, Flags [none], length 1492 52:54:00:ad:87:fd > 52:54:00:79:5c:d0, ethertype PPPoE S (0x8864), length 27: PPPoE [ses 0x1] MLPPP (0x003d), length 7: seq 0x000, Flags [end], length 5 And the ICMPv4 echo request is successfully received at the server side: IP (tos 0x0, ttl 64, id 21925, offset 0, flags [DF], proto ICMP (1), length 2976) 192.168.222.2 > 192.168.15.254: ICMP echo request, id 30530, seq 0, length 2956 The bug was introduced in commit c9aa6895371b2a257401f59d3393c9f7ac5a8698 ("[PPPOE]: Advertise PPPoE MTU") from the very beginning. 2014-11-23md/raid6: avoid data corruption during recovery of double-degraded RAID6NeilBrown
During recovery of a double-degraded RAID6 it is possible for some blocks not to be recovered properly, leading to corruption. If a write happens to one block in a stripe that would be written to a missing device, and at the same time that stripe is recovering data to the other missing device, then that recovered data may not be written. This patch skips, in the double-degraded case, an optimisation that is only safe for single-degraded arrays. Bug was introduced in 2.6.32 and fix is suitable for any kernel since then. In an older kernel with separate handle_stripe5() and handle_stripe6() functions the patch must change handle_stripe6(). 2014-11-23fix misuses of f_count() in ppp and netlinkAl Viro
we used to check for "nobody else could start doing anything with that opened file" by checking that refcount was 2 or less - one for descriptor table and one we'd acquired in fget() on the way to wherever we are. That was race-prone (somebody else might have had a reference to descriptor table and do fget() just as we'd been checking) and it had become flat-out incorrect back when we switched to fget_light() on those codepaths - unlike fget(), it doesn't grab an extra reference unless the descriptor table is shared. The same change allowed a race-free check, though - we are safe exactly when refcount is less than 2. It was a long time ago; pre-2.6.12 for ioctl() (the codepath leading to ppp one) and 2.6.17 for sendmsg() (netlink one). OTOH, netlink hadn't grown that check until 3.9 and ppp used to live in drivers/net, not drivers/net/ppp until 3.1. The bug existed well before that, though, and the same fix used to apply in old location of file. 2014-11-23dm crypt: fix access beyond the end of allocated spaceMikulas Patocka
commit d49ec52ff6ddcda178fc2476a109cf1bd1fa19ed upstream The DM crypt target accesses memory beyond allocated space resulting in a crash on 32 bit x86 systems. This bug is very old (it dates back to 2.6.25 commit 3a7f6c990ad04 "dm crypt: use async crypto"). However, this bug was masked by the fact that kmalloc rounds the size up to the next power of two. This bug wasn't exposed until 3.17-rc1 commit 298a9fa08a ("dm crypt: use per-bio data"). By switching to using per-bio data there was no longer any padding beyond the end of a dm-crypt allocated memory block. To minimize allocation overhead dm-crypt puts several structures into one block allocated with kmalloc. The block holds struct ablkcipher_request, cipher-specific scratch pad (crypto_ablkcipher_reqsize(any_tfm(cc))), struct dm_crypt_request and an initialization vector. The variable dmreq_start is set to offset of struct dm_crypt_request within this memory block. dm-crypt allocates the block with this size: cc->dmreq_start + sizeof(struct dm_crypt_request) + cc->iv_size. When accessing the initialization vector, dm-crypt uses the function iv_of_dmreq, which performs this calculation: ALIGN((unsigned long)(dmreq + 1), crypto_ablkcipher_alignmask(any_tfm(cc)) + 1). dm-crypt allocated "cc->iv_size" bytes beyond the end of dm_crypt_request structure. However, when dm-crypt accesses the initialization vector, it takes a pointer to the end of dm_crypt_request, aligns it, and then uses it as the initialization vector. If the end of dm_crypt_request is not aligned on a crypto_ablkcipher_alignmask(any_tfm(cc)) boundary the alignment causes the initialization vector to point beyond the allocated space. Fix this bug by calculating the variable iv_size_padding and adding it to the allocated size. Also correct the alignment of dm_crypt_request. struct dm_crypt_request is specific to dm-crypt (it isn't used by the crypto subsystem at all), so it is aligned on __alignof__(struct dm_crypt_request). 2014-11-23sym53c8xx_2: Set DID_REQUEUE return code when aborting squeueMikulas Patocka
Hi This is backport of commit fd1232b214af43a973443aec6a2808f16ee5bf70. It is suitable for all stable branches up to and including 3.14.* Mikulas commit fd1232b214af43a973443aec6a2808f16ee5bf70 Author: Mikulas Patocka <mpatocka@redhat.com> Date: Tue Apr 8 21:52:05 2014 -0400 sym53c8xx_2: Set DID_REQUEUE return code when aborting squeue This patch fixes I/O errors with the sym53c8xx_2 driver when the disk returns QUEUE FULL status. When the controller encounters an error (including QUEUE FULL or BUSY status), it aborts all not yet submitted requests in the function sym_dequeue_from_squeue. This function aborts them with DID_SOFT_ERROR. If the disk has full tag queue, the request that caused the overflow is aborted with QUEUE FULL status (and the scsi midlayer properly retries it until it is accepted by the disk), but the sym53c8xx_2 driver aborts the following requests with DID_SOFT_ERROR --- for them, the midlayer does just a few retries and then signals the error up to sd. The result is that disk returning QUEUE FULL causes request failures. The error was reproduced on 53c895 with COMPAQ BD03685A24 disk (rebranded ST336607LC) with command queue 48 or 64 tags. The disk has 64 tags, but under some access patterns it return QUEUE FULL when there are less than 64 pending tags. The SCSI specification allows returning QUEUE FULL anytime and it is up to the host to retry. 2014-05-19dm snapshot: fix data corruptionMikulas Patocka
CVE-2013-4299 BugLink: http://bugs.launchpad.net/bugs/1241769 This patch fixes a particular type of data corruption that has been encountered when loading a snapshot's metadata from disk. When we allocate a new chunk in persistent_prepare, we increment ps->next_free and we make sure that it doesn't point to a metadata area by further incrementing it if necessary. When we load metadata from disk on device activation, ps->next_free is positioned after the last used data chunk. However, if this last used data chunk is followed by a metadata area, ps->next_free is positioned erroneously to the metadata area. A newly-allocated chunk is placed at the same location as the metadata area, resulting in data or metadata corruption. This patch changes the code so that ps->next_free skips the metadata area when metadata are loaded in function read_exceptions. The patch also moves a piece of code from persistent_prepare_exception to a separate function skip_metadata to avoid code duplication. 2014-05-19n_tty: Fix n_tty_write crash when echoing in raw modePeter Hurley
The tty atomic_write_lock does not provide an exclusion guarantee for the tty driver if the termios settings are LECHO & !OPOST. And since it is unexpected and not allowed to call TTY buffer helpers like tty_insert_flip_string concurrently, this may lead to crashes when concurrect writers call pty_write. In that case the following two writers: * the ECHOing from a workqueue and * pty_write from the process race and can overflow the corresponding TTY buffer like follows. If we look into tty_insert_flip_string_fixed_flag, there is: int space = __tty_buffer_request_room(port, goal, flags); struct tty_buffer *tb = port->buf.tail; ... memcpy(char_buf_ptr(tb, tb->used), chars, space); ... tb->used += space; so the race of the two can result in something like this: A B __tty_buffer_request_room __tty_buffer_request_room memcpy(buf(tb->used), ...) tb->used += space; memcpy(buf(tb->used), ...) ->BOOM B's memcpy is past the tty_buffer due to the previous A's tb->used increment. Since the N_TTY line discipline input processing can output concurrently with a tty write, obtain the N_TTY ldisc output_lock to serialize echo output with normal tty writes. This ensures the tty buffer helper tty_insert_flip_string is not called concurrently and everything is fine. Note that this is nicely reproducible by an ordinary user using forkpty and some setup around that (raw termios + ECHO).
